Output 154f21b450ebe02f5870742f13a5ca99ffca386f14381934b63f2c0be2a7c15d:36

value
16294437
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08edc62cf38e4039a5d1e6ff9a0524671705477e OP_EQUALVERIFY OP_CHECKSIG
address
1pDFNUv5SuxfTLDDbQQ5xduR9qHbAnKcz
transaction
154f21b450ebe02f5870742f13a5ca99ffca386f14381934b63f2c0be2a7c15d
spent
true